FELIX JAEHN JOINS FORCES WITH ROBIN SCHULZ FOR SULTRY NEW SINGLE ‘I GOT A FEELING’ WITH GEORGIA KU

ANNOUNCES SOPHOMORE ALBUM ‘BREATHE’,
SET FOR RELEASE ON OCTOBER 1

OUT NOW VIA UNIVERSAL MUSIC

Following the success of their smash single ‘One More Time’ ft. Alida, Felix Jaehn and Robin Schulz have joined forces again to deliver another contagious new single that’s primed for the summertime. ‘I Got A Feeling’ features the vocal talent Georgia Ku, who has collaborated with the likes of Illenium, Martin Jensen, Party Favor and more. Joining together at an apex between their signature sounds, Felix Jaehn and Robin Schulz remind fans why they are an unstoppable force when collaborating. Out now via Universal Music, ‘I Got A Feeling’ is available to stream across platforms.

I Got A Feeling’ opens with a sultry melody that immediately captivates the audience. In true Felix Jaehn fashion, the single is uplifting with groovy sensibilities and commanding vocals while Robin Schulz adds his own unique flair to the track. Georgia Ku lends her intriguing talent with catchy vocals that effortlessly complement the wavy soundscape. The pop-dance crossover track serves as another intriguing addition to Felix Jaehn’s cheerful discography and is destined to be another smash hit for the young artist. Much like the rest of his recent work, ‘I Got A Feeling’ explores different perspectives of mental health with resonating vocals and a yearning and warm sonic landscape.

German producer Robin Schulz was also a story of seemingly overnight success and has had quite the noteworthy career in the realm of dance music. His fame began with his remixes for ‘Prayer In C’ and ‘Waves’ and has only skyrocketed since then, with the release of four studio albums, countless collaborations, and millions of streams to-date. Schulz currently commands 24 million monthly Spotify listeners and has just released his fourth studio album ‘IIII’ earlier this year. Robin Schulz and Felix Jaehn have joined forces in the studio before ‘I Got A Feeling’ as their signature sounds meld together in an unparalleled way. Their smash single ‘One More Time’ feat. Alida has amassed nearly 50 million collective streams and serves as a focal point for his latest studio album.

Another fellow collaborator, this is not the first time Felix Jaehn has joined forces with singer and songwriter Georgia Ku. The pair originally linked for the collaboration with NOTD and Captain Cuts on the single ‘So Close’. In addition to her own budding discography, the England-born artist has also supplemented her own output with collaborations with dance music icons such as Felix JaehnParty FavorMatomaMartin Jensen and more. Her original tracks have also received remixes from the likes of Benny Benassi and Afrojack. As a songwriter, her discography includes the massive hit ‘Scared To Be Lonely’ by Martin Garrix and Dua Lipa and most recently, Jlo's collaboration with Rauw Alejandro 'Cambia El Paso'. STEREOTYPE ANNOUNCE NEW ALBUM WITH SIZZLING NEW SINGLE ‘HEATWAVE (FEAT. CUT_)’

Stereotype_Heatwave_Artwork_Aug2021.jpg

Israeli duo Adam and Leon, aka Stereotype, mark the announcement of a new album Nowhere by dropping new single, 'Heatwave (feat. CUT_)'. Following years of crafting their sound, the pair arrive ready to unveil their first full-length release, and 'Heatwave' is a perfect snapshot of where they are sonically and is a testament to the sacrifices and countless hours of work both have put in to hone their skills. 

That technical ability is on show in abundance. Stereotype stays true to their vision to work with artists they have relationships with and inspire them, by drafting in Dutch electronic duo CUT_ on 'Heatwave'. Leaning on the act's vocalist, Belle Doron, who provides vocals and lyrics that are both accomplished and ideally suited to the instrumental, Stereotype manage to navigate the challenges of distance and collaboration to unveil a cohesive track that will have fans itching to hear more around the album.  

'Heatwave' begins with vintage sounding detuned chords, which provide the soundbed for Belle's vocals to flourish, teasing the song's theme right from the beginning. A kick and clap are introduced to signal the first chorus vocal being introduced, setting the stage for the first drop of the track, aided by claps, which increase in intensity and further build on the anticipation. Next, glitching leads are introduced along with a heavy bassline, creating a groove that interacts playfully with Belle's vocal, cleverly re-sampled and edited, keeping the track fresh throughout and highlighting Stereotype's considerable prowess in the studio. 

On the message behing ‘Heatwave’, Beth from CUT_ said the song is “an all-consuming love between two people. she tried to summon a feeling of passion and sensuality but also the feeling that it's a bit scary using the metaphor of a heatwave."

'Heatwave' is an impressive statement from a production duo who continue to turn heads with their unique genre-hopping brand of electronic music. With this release, and news of an upcoming album dropping on 3rd September, it's clear the pair have arrived at the tipping point, ready to share their evolution in sound with the world.

GARENA FREE FIRE’S 4TH YEAR ANNIVERSARY CELEBRATIONS ARE LED BY DIMITRI VEGAS & LIKE MIKE, KSHMR, ZAFRIR AND ALOK

An all-star cast of electronic superstars, Dimitri Vegas & Like Mike, KSHMR, Zafrir and Alok have combined to release 'Reunion', the official theme song celebrating the 4th anniversary of Garena Free Fire – one of the world's most downloaded mobile games.

A song primed for the combat field, 'Reunion' builds with its chanting vocal before a thundering drum pattern signals that the battle is commencing. As the military drums echo through the atmosphere, the song drops before unleashing a mighty kick that explodes into a flurry of explosive big room bass rhythms and melodies. The Free Fire celebrations are underway as the all-out musical war unfolds to devastating effect!

Brazilian electronic star Alok has long been immortalised within the Free Fire landscape, making his foray into the game back in 2020 - the first Brazilian artist to have a life-like avatar in a game. This month Garena announced that former 2 x World No.1 DJ's Dimitri Vegas & Like Mike would also be entering Free Fire with their in-game characters soon.

Electronic music lovers and fans worldwide know Dimitri & Mike Thivaios as the monolithic brotherly duo "Dimitri Vegas & Like Mike" and ambassadors of the worldwide phenomenon Tomorrowland. The brothers are superstars in the electronic music scene. They have earned the adoration of crowds around the globe, thanks to a string of hit singles and collaborations with the likes of Snoop Dogg, Wiz Khalifa, Ne-Yo, David Guetta, Paris Hilton, and Hans Zimmer.

Niles Hollowell-Dhar, better known as KSHMR, has been a regular face in electronic music for several years now. From releases on many of the scene's biggest labels, he has also collaborated with the likes of Tiësto, Kaskade, Martin Solveig and Kylie, and produced for Selena Gomez, Sean Paul and Robin Thicke.

DJ/producer Zafrir s the most streamed Brazilian artist globally with over 3 billion streams on Spotify alone with hits such as 'On & On' and 'Party on my Own'. Alok has previously reworked hits for music heavyweights, including The Rolling Stones, Dua Lipa and Meduza. Ranked fifth in the Top 100 DJs poll, Alok has collaborated with artists including Jason Derulo, Tove Lo, Martin Jensen and Armin van Buuren.

An incredibly well-versed musician who can play over 20 instruments, Zafrir has co-written with artists including names like Armin van Buuren, Vini Vici and Timmy Trumpet. And this year alone has had releases on Maximize, Controversia, Dharma and Spinnin' Records.
